Wellington sits in the Rocky Mountain West. In 2024 it voted Republican.
Across the recorded series it reached a Republican high of 24.6 points in 2016. Between 2020 and 2024 the city moved 2.8 points toward the Democratic candidate; the 2024 margin was 13.1 points.
A population of 11,798, a 79% non-Hispanic-white share, and a median household income of $107,017 describe the city.
